HTML5 audio and video support
13 avril 2011, parMediaSPIP uses HTML5 video and audio tags to play multimedia files, taking advantage of the latest W3C innovations supported by modern browsers.
The MediaSPIP player used has been created specifically for MediaSPIP and can be easily adapted to fit in with a specific theme.
For older browsers the Flowplayer flash fallback is used.

Resizing AVIF images with transparency with FFmpeg [closed]
4 octobre 2024, par CalebmerI'm trying to resize an image with transparency with FFmpeg, however the output looks to only be a resized version of the alpha layer.


When I try to do a noop transform of the AVIF image with an alpha layer :


ffmpeg -i input.avif output.avif



output.avif
appears to be the alpha layer with black representing alpha 0 and white representing alpha 1.

Seeing there are two streams (the first stream being
gray(pc)
, probably the alpha layer) I next tried :

ffmpeg -i input.avif -map 0:v:1 output.avif



To see the second stream and it gave me the image without any alpha channel. Transparent pixels were black.


Ultimately I want to resize the AVIF file with
ffmpeg -i input.avif -vf "scale=iw/2:-1" output.avif
but that appears to only resize the greyscale alpha channel. Furthermore, this will be part of a script that operates on some AVIF files without an alpha channel and some AVIF files with an alpha channel and I don't know which files have an alpha channel ahead of time.ffmpeg -i input.avif -vf "scale=iw/2:-1" output.avif
works for files without an alpha channel.
